Summary Of Fee's Payable By Tenants - (Applies to Assured Periodic Tenancies (APTs) in England from 1 May 2026, in line with the Tenant Fees Act 2019 and Renters’ Rights Act 2025)
Please be aware that your tenancy may be subject to the following charges. All amounts include VAT at the current rate of 20%, where applicable, and may be subject to change should the VAT rate increase.
BEFORE YOU MOVE IN:
•Holding Deposit Fee: Equal to one week’s rent. This is payable once your offer on a property has been accepted and will be offset against the first month’s rent or tenancy deposit, as agreed. Please note that the holding deposit may be retained if you withdraw your offer, provide false or misleading information, fail a Right to Rent check, or do not take all reasonable steps to enter into the tenancy within the agreed timeframe.
•First Month’s Rent: Due after signing the tenancy agreement, less any holding deposit paid
•Security Deposit: Equivalent to 5 weeks’ rent (where annual rent is under £50,000). This will be protected in a government-approved tenancy deposit scheme.
DURING YOUR TENANCY:
•Changes or Amendments to the Tenancy Agreement (requested by the tenant): £50
•Late Rent Payments: Charged once rent is 14 days overdue, at a rate of 3% above the Bank of England base rate, calculated from the date the rent became overdue
•Lost Keys or Security Devices: Charged at the reasonable cost of replacement.
•Early Termination (Tenant’s Request): If you wish to end the tenancy early or do not provide the required notice, you will be liable for the landlord’s reasonable costs. This may include rent due for the remainder of the notice period (typically two months), or until a new tenancy is secured.
